Web1. liberal in giving or sharing; unselfish. 2. free from meanness or pettiness; magnanimous. 3. large; abundant: a generous piece of pie. 4. rich or strong in flavor: a generous wine. 5. fertile; prolific: generous soil. [1580–90; < Middle French généreux < Latin generōsus of noble birth < gener-, genus genus + -ōsus -ous] gen′er•ous•ly, adv.
